Minimarket Worker Convicted of Battery
A Panorama City service station worker was found guilty Monday of sexually attacking a woman in December as she worked in the stockroom, authorities said.
Magdi Helmy, 37, was convicted of sexual battery and battery by a Van Nuys Municipal Court jury after a five-day trial.
Helmy, who is free on his own recognizance, was ordered to return to court May 20 for sentencing. He faces up to six months in jail and a $2,000 fine.
Helmy was found guilty of attacking a female employee of a food distribution company as she inventoried items in the service station’s minimarket on Roscoe Boulevard.
Helmy had suggested the woman move her work to the stockroom for convenience. In the stockroom, he approached her from behind, grabbing her right breast and rubbed his body against hers.
